What Is Spray Foam Insulation?
How Spray Foam Insulation Works
Spray foam insulation is applied as a liquid that expands into a thick foam once sprayed into place. As it expands, it fills small gaps, cracks, and spaces that traditional insulation may miss.
This expansion creates a tight seal that reduces air leaks in the attic.
Because of this sealing effect, spray foam insulation is known for strong energy performance.
Types of Spray Foam Insulation
There are two main types used in attics.
Open Cell Spray Foam
Open cell foam is softer and lighter. It expands quickly and fills open spaces in attic cavities.
Closed Cell Spray Foam
Closed cell foam is denser and more rigid. It provides a higher insulation value and also helps resist moisture.
Both types are effective depending on the structure of the attic and insulation goals.

What Is Fiberglass Insulation?
How Fiberglass Insulation Works
Fiberglass insulation is made from very thin glass fibers. These fibers trap pockets of air, which helps slow down heat transfer.
Fiberglass is commonly installed in two forms:
- Batts or rolls placed between attic joists
- Loose fill insulation blown into attic spaces
This type of insulation has been used in homes for decades.

Air Sealing and Draft Protection
Air leaks in the attic are one of the main reasons homes lose energy. Small gaps around vents, wiring, and framing can allow outside air to enter the home and make temperature control more difficult.
Spray foam
- Expands as it is applied and fills cracks, gaps, and small openings
- Creates an airtight seal across the attic space
- Helps eliminate drafts coming from the roof area
- Improves the overall efficiency of the home
Fiberglass
- Insulates surfaces but does not seal air gaps
- Air can still move through small openings in the attic
- Drafts may remain if the attic is not properly air sealed
- May require additional sealing around vents and penetrations

Cost Comparison
Cost is another important factor when comparing insulation types. Spray foam and fiberglass have very different upfront prices, but they also differ in long term value and energy savings.
Spray foam
- Usually costs about $3 to $7 per square foot, depending on the type and thickness installed
- Higher upfront installation cost
- Requires professional equipment and trained installers
- Creates an airtight seal that can help lower heating and cooling costs over time
- Often considered a premium insulation option because of its performance and durability
Fiberglass
- Typically costs around $0.30 to $1.50 per square foot
- Lower initial material and installation cost
- Common choice for budget friendly attic insulation projects
- Helps improve energy efficiency but does not seal air leaks
- May need upgrades or additional insulation sooner than spray foam
While spray foam costs more at the start, many homeowners see long term savings through improved energy efficiency and lower utility bills.
Things to Consider Before Choosing Attic Insulation
Choosing the right insulation is not only about the material itself. The design of your attic, your climate, and the current condition of your home all influence which insulation will perform best. Understanding these factors can help you make a smarter decision when upgrading your roof and attic insulation.
- Climate conditions
Homes in hotter climates need insulation that reduces heat entering through the roof. Strong thermal performance can help keep indoor temperatures stable and reduce cooling costs. - Attic structure
Some attics have complex framing, tight corners, or irregular spaces. In these cases, expanding insulation like spray foam can fill gaps more effectively than traditional materials. - Existing insulation
Many homes already have fiberglass insulation installed. If it is damaged, compressed, or outdated, adding new insulation or replacing it may significantly improve performance. - Energy efficiency goals
Some homeowners prioritize long term energy savings, while others focus on keeping upfront costs lower. Your goals will influence which insulation option makes the most sense. - Ventilation and moisture control
Proper attic ventilation is important for insulation performance. Managing humidity and moisture helps protect the roof structure and prevents mold problems.
